      Issue Summary

      When editing a page, by pasting the share link got from the advanced roadmap for Jira for the Confluence page embedding, it shows the macro as expected, but upon publishing it published only a link.

      Steps to Reproduce

      1. Create a new page
      2. Go to the advanced roadmap in Jira and click on Share button
      3. Get the link to share it on Confluence
      4. Paste the link directly on the Page or insert the macro by typing /advanced and paste the link on the macro
      5. Preview it and Save/insert
      6. Publish the page

      Expected Results

      The macro is visible on the published page

      Actual Results

      The macro only works in edit mode, on published mode it is showing the link instead.

      Workaround

      Currently there is no known workaround for this behavior. A workaround will be added here when available
